Periodize Your Training: Option cycle trading involves dividing time into specific cycles. Similarly, weightlifting training can benefit from periodization, which allows for systematic variations in intensity and volume. Incorporating cycles of higher volume and lower intensity, followed by cycles of lower volume and higher intensity, will help prevent plateaus and optimize progress. 3.
